CBS SPORTS SPECTACULAR FINDS ITS MOJO WITH "MOJO 6 RACEWAY GOLF" ON SATURDAY AND SUNDAY

CBS SPORTS SPECTACULAR showcases a new, innovative golf format that combines the best elements of traditional play with one-on-one match-ups with the MOJO 6 RACEWAY GOLF on Saturday, May 1 and Sunday, May 2 (2:00-3:00 PM, ET; both days; taped 4/15-16) from Cinnamon Hill Golf Course at Rose Hall in Montego Bay, Jamaica.  This inaugural LPGA-sanctioned tournament marks the return of professional women's golf to Jamaica and the Caribbean for the first time in two decades.  Played over two days, The MOJO 6 RACEWAY GOLF pits 16 top players vying for a $1 million purse against each in a series of six-hole matches to crown a winner.  On the first day, each golfer has three separate six-hole matches to accumulate points to establish a Day One ranking from 1 to 16.  The top eight golfers move on to Day Two, Championship Day, and compete in a tournament bracket single-elimination, where three match victories crown the champion.  Raceway Golf players face new challenges throughout the tournament as hole set-up changes after each round forcing players to develop personal strategies and make risk-reward considerations when picking their opponents on Day One. The field of 16 players includes Brittany Lincicome, Cristie Kerr, Suzann Pettersen, Song-Hee Kim, Kristy McPherson, Yani Tseng, Anna Nordqvist, Amanda Blumenherst, Na Yeon Choi, Angela Stanford, Morgan Pressel, Christina Kim, Beatriz Recari, Sophie Gustafson, Britany Lang and Maria Stackhouse.  CBS Sports' Bill Macatee, along with Jill McGill, Paula Creamer and Anna Rawson call the action.  CBS Sports' Andy Goldberg serves as Coordinating Producer.

  

CBS SPORTS BROADCASTS PGA OF AMERICA'S "A PASSION FOR GOLF, PGA PROFESSIONALS AND YOU" ON SUNDAY

Hosted by Bill Macatee on Sunday, May 2 (1:00-2:00 PM, ET; taped), A PASSION FOR GOLF, PGA PROFESSIONALS AND YOU is a PGA of America special designed to kick off "Free Lesson Month" and generate additional interest and participation in the game of golf. "Get Golf Ready" along with "Play Golf America's Free Lesson Month," "Women in Golf Month" and "Family Golf Month" will be featured to provide viewers with opportunities to learn how to play or hone their skills. Indianapolis Colts Safety Melvin Bullitt has participated in "Play Golf America" programs and will share his passion for the game. The special will showcase the personalized stories of several PGA professionals and their mentoring of juniors and PGA and LPGA Tour players. These in-depth stories include: Mike Bender, 2009 PGA Teacher of the Year;  Randy Smith, 1996 PGA Professional of the Year and 2002 PGA Teacher of the Year; Lynn Marriott and Pia Nilsson, "Operate Vision 54" who are the two highest regarded women instructors in the world; and Jeff Dunovant, Director of Instruction for "The First Tee" of East Lake in Atlanta, Ga. He and his father are the first and only black father and son PGA members.  CBS Sports' Chris Svendsen serves as Coordinating Producer.

 

 

CBS SPORTS SPECTACULAR MOTORS ALONG WITH MONSTER ENERGY AMA SUPERCROSS IN SALT LAKE CITY ON SUNDAY

CBS SPORTS SPECTACULAR presents MONSTER ENERGY AMA SUPERCROSS on Sunday, May 2 (12:00 Noon-1:00 PM, ET; taped 5/1), from the Rice-Eccles Stadium in Salt Lake City, Utah.  All eyes will be on 2010 Monster Energy AMA Supercross Champion Ryan Dungey as he secured the championship last weekend with a fourth place finish in Seattle, and is a favorite to win in Salt Lake City.  He will be chased in the season's penultimate race by a field of talented riders including Kevin Winham and Josh HillRalph Sheheen, Jeff Emig and Erin Bates call the action for CBS Sports.  CBS Sports' John Paquet serves as coordinating producer.
